The vast majority of Republicans voted against the bill that had already been approved by a bipartisan Senate vote.
While much of the focus has been on divisions between progressive and moderate Democrats as they battled over the bipartisan bill and the separate Build Back Better Act, Friday's vote appeared to expose a split within the GOP as well.of Colorado's 3rd congressional district referred to the 13 as Republicans In Name Only ."Pelosi did not have the votes in her party to pass this garbage. Time to name names and hold these fake republicans accountable," she wrote.
Representative Andy Biggs of Arizona's 5th congressional district tweeted:"Republicans who voted for the Democrats' socialist spending bill are the very reason why Americans don't trustRepublicans who voted for the Democrats’ socialist spending bill are the very reason why Americans don’t trust Congress.
